You Can Homeschool Kindergarten Without Fear—Use These 4 Things

Homeschooling kindergarten is tricky only when you overthink it. Trust your curriculum, focus on the basics, take cues from your child, use lots of repetition, and cultivate a love for learning. Those are the basics!
